Encalc is a free online scientific calculator. It is able to handle dimensional analysis, perform symbolic algebra and calculus, define variables, look up values from a database of physical constants, and graph. Encalc also aupports parentheses and scientific formulas.
Encalc can be used when a student has misplaced his/her calculator and needs a scientific calculator to use. As a school in which a TI-84 is necessary, this tool may be very useful to some forgetful students.

CBBC is a BBC television channel whose target audience is aimed towards 4 to 12 year olds. However, I think that high school students could also use this site as an educational tool. Its website features free kids' games, television shows, clips, music, art activities, and news. The television shows and games on this website are fun and educational, usually pertaining to science. Also, the news reports that are featured on this website include world news, sports news, and even entertainment news. Furthermore, there is a really neat section about animals, where children can learn about all different types of animals and the latest news concerning animals.

Flatworld Knowledge provides textbooks online for free. This website also has apps so you can view your textbooks on your iPad or iPhone. They also have a way to view your textbooks offline just in case you don't have internet.
